Output 0c64d2c2084426e710c73f700b5073749db1658509302df5f27da07fd214e56f:2

value
1439693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8457c95d9fe31760d32eb51d3a7b8d250e6befa OP_EQUAL
address
3QKkk8pMcJTkXuzJJc4b9G44fX5LpodUPB
transaction
0c64d2c2084426e710c73f700b5073749db1658509302df5f27da07fd214e56f
confirmations
337658
spent
true